Why limit caffeine during pregnancy?
According to the American College of Obstetricians and Gynecologists (ACOG) , excessive caffeine consumption (over 200 mg per day) may be associated with increased risks of low birth weight or miscarriage ( ACOG Committee Opinion No. 462, 2010 ).
👉 Hence the importance of finding caffeine-free alternatives.
Chicory: a comforting drink without the risk of overstimulation
- 0% caffeine : perfect for keeping the coffee ritual without the side effects.
- Rich in prebiotic fiber (inulin) : promotes digestive health, often put to the test during pregnancy.
- Coffee-like flavor : Roasted chicory offers an aromatic depth reminiscent of coffee, without the nervous excitement.
What the research says
Studies in English highlight the benefits of chicory in food:
- Research published in Critical Reviews in Food Science and Nutrition (2013) highlights the beneficial effects of inulin on gut health and metabolism.
- Chicory is known for its antioxidant properties (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ry, 2005 ).
⚠️ Important note : As with any dietary change during pregnancy, it is recommended to consult a doctor or midwife before introducing chicory on a regular basis.
